NUCLEAR REACTOR SAFETY PROTECTION DEVICE AND METHOD FOR DETERMINING ABNORMALITY OF SOLENOID OF SOLENOID VALVE

摘要

PROBLEM TO BE SOLVED: To determine abnormality of either one of a plurality of solenoids of solenoid valves by a simple configuration in a nuclear reactor safety protection device.SOLUTION: A nuclear reactor safety protection device 1 includes: a plurality of solenoids 6 of solenoid valves connected in parallel; a power supply 4 for supplying the solenoids 6 of the solenoid valves with power; an excitation contact 7 for cutting off the power by an opening operation; a current measuring section 15 for measuring a current flowing through the excitation contact 7 as a current measurement value 31; an excitation determining section 12 for determining that the plurality of solenoids 6 of the solenoid valves are excited by the fact that the current measurement value 31 exceeds an excitation determining threshold; and a solenoid abnormality determining section 13 for determining that, when the excitation determining section 12 determines that the plurality of solenoids 6 of the solenoid valves are excited and the solenoid abnormality determining threshold is less than the current measurement value 31, there is abnormality in one of the solenoids 6 of the solenoid valves.
